HNC Mechanical Engineering
This programme provides learners with the advanced skills and knowledge required to work as a technician in the mechanical engineering industry. You will develop an understanding of mechanical engineering which will enable you develop processes and products from small component designs to large plants, machinery or vehicles. You could work on all stages of a product; from research and development to design and manufacture, installation and final commissioning. During this course you will study modules that focus on areas such as analytical methods for engineers, project design, mechanical principles, engineering science, plus other specialist topics that meet demands of local industry.
You will be assessed using a variety of different methods, including software simulation, lab reports, written reports and assignments.
You will be invited into college to attend an informal interview where your suitability to the course will be assessed.
BTEC National Diploma in Manufacturing Engineering, A-Level in Maths or an appropriate science-based subject, An additional A-Level in any subject, Five GCSEs at grade C or above, including maths and science. Mature applicants (aged 21 years and older) with no formal qualifications, but with relevant industrial experience, are also welcome to apply.
